LIKELY DEVELOPMENTS AND FUTURE RESULTSThere are no likely developments in the operations of the consolidated entity, constituted by the Computershare Group and theentities it controls from time to time, that were not finalised at the date of this report.The Company continues to target long term growth in management earnings per share of 20% per year, to be achieved by acombination of organic growth and acquisitions, as well as balance sheet management. Looking to financial year 2009 and havingregard to current equity and interest rate market conditions, the Company expects management earnings per share to be morethan 10% higher than financial year <strong>2008</strong>.02-13OverviewENVIRONMENTAL REGULATIONSThe Computershare Group is not subject to significant environmental regulation.INFORMATION ON DIRECTORSThe qualifications, experience and responsibilities of directors together with details of all directorships of other listed companiesheld by a director in the three years to 30 June <strong>2008</strong> and any contracts to which the director is a party to under which they areentitled to a benefit are outlined in the Corporate Governance Statement and form part of this report.Directors’ InterestsAt the date of this report, the direct and indirect interests of the directors in the securities of the Company are:Name Number of ordinary shares Number of performance rightsC.J.
